PFI: The Financialisation of Everything

Grace Blakely, a researcher on finance and public policy, delves into the Private Finance Initiative (PFI) and its detrimental impact on the UK public sector. She examines the PFI's intricate workings, highlighting its promotion as a solution that ultimately prioritized corporate profits over public welfare. Blakely highlights the catastrophic collapse of Carillion as a case study of financialised failure, urging a reevaluation of public ownership models. The discussion sheds light on the cultural implications of financialisation and the urgent need for systemic change in public spending.
